Klaus Gottschalk

HPC & Machine-Learning Architect, IBM
 

Klaus Gottschalk is HPC- and machine learning architect at IBM. After he graduated with major in Mathematics he joined IBM in 1992 as HPC engineer. He is focusing on parallel system architecture, data analytics, machine learning and system sizing. Klaus is well connected with HPC- and AI customers in Europe and worldwide and is an expert in large system design.
